To remove the
keyboard, complete
the following steps:
1.
Prepare the
computer for
disassembly.
2. Remove the
palmrest cover with
touch
pad.
3. Gently lift up the
front of the keyboard
and disconnect the
flex cable from the
ZIF connector on the
system board.
To remove a
cable from a
ZIF connector,
lift both
corners of the
ZIF connector
and slide
simultaneously
with constant
light force.
Then remove
